## Build Provenance: FareSpin Pricing Experiment

Hey plugin folks — the FareSpin ticket-pricing experiment ships in staged builds, so your plugins may see different price surfaces depending on which artifact they load against. Always check provenance before filing bugs; half the "weird pricing" reports last month were stale builds. The canonical trace for the current experiment build is below.

pipeline stamp: htk31_f769b577b3028a4e9958e5bb8d1259a

Subject: Lost Badge Procedure for Contractors

Hello,

If you misplace your contractor badge while on the Veltrane Systems campus, report it to the front desk immediately so we can deactivate it. A replacement will be issued once your supervisor at Orbix Fitouts confirms your assignment. Until then, you must be escorted in all restricted zones. For after-hours access to the loading corridor while your replacement is processed, use the temporary pass code below.

door code, yagap-bahof: bdg-O-05

## Artifact Signing — PointsLedger Releases

All builds of the Quillmark loyalty-points ledger must be signed before promotion to staging. Verify the manifest checksum, confirm the build came from the protected branch, and record the release number in the Brindlewood tracker. Unsigned artifacts are rejected automatically by the gate. The current release signing key for PointsLedger builds is as follows.

rollout seal: bky4_x7Gc